Omaha is comparable to Holdem in the sense that you wager on with cards against the board. In Omaha you hold four cards as opposed to 2 and there are 5 community cards. To make a hand, you have to wager on two holecards with 3 board cards. The gambling strategies are the identical as those used in Texas holdem.
Usually, Omaha hold’em is subject to the very same rules at Hold em. The only rules that are different apply to the board. In Omaha/8, you need to use 2 cards out of your hand and three cards from the board. The most common varieties of Omaha hold’em poker are high-low splits and 8-or-better.

Understanding Omaha Values An crucial point about Omaha hold’em poker: you acquire a greater percentage of your final hand sooner, receiving four cards for your hand as opposed to 2, as in Holdem. Seven ninths of the hand is recognized within the flop; when it comes to betting, you also know a lot more and thus can generate additional informed decisions. Compared to Texas hold’em poker, Omaha hold’em has a great deal less to do with random outcomes. It is really a game won by interpreting details; Texas hold em depends upon interpreting uncertainty.
That said, what matters in Omaha hold’em poker as a lot as in any other variation: the probability of winning. In Omaha hi-low, the number of cards and the combinations of winning hands are what count. This version of poker is about accuracy, clarity, and, we…rsquo;ll say it once again, about information. You must look at the various combinations of your respective hand: what’s the very best combination of 3 cards from the board and two from your hand? What is the weakest combination? You also must look at what cards are not around the table or inside your hand and use that details to assess what hands your opponents have. As you are able to see far more cards in Omaha high than you can in, say, Texas hold em or Stud poker, you…rsquo;re chances of being appropriate about the chances of winning having a particular hand are that much higher.

A couple of critical concepts The River Game: You may perhaps hear players refer to Omaha high as a river game, which is basically saying that the final card determines the winning hand. This theory emerged because it generally seems that only 2 gamblers per round have viable hands. Weighing this theory as a strong one, numerous Omaha players have been recognized to hold off wagering until the last card comes down.
In reality, ahead of the flop, it is best to bet on hands that have a good expectation; you need to manipulate the pot size and you ought to try to manipulate your opponents. After the flop you ought to begin to roughly calculate the probabilities and deduce how favorable your chances are to win. Once more, you need to be working to manipulate the pot if you have a strong hand.
Pot Manipulation: To win at Omaha high poker, you ought to manipulate the pot to a number of extent. This means you ought to make a determination early on whether it’s worth wagering snd you must act on your determination.
Cooperation: Greedy gamblers don…rsquo;t bet on Omaha hold’em poker incredibly well. It is best to cooperate with your opponents to extract bids from weaker players. Greed will price you money in Omaha poker.
